Como tocar Mrs. Potato Head no ukulele
Para tocar Mrs. Potato Head no ukulele, dê a batida levada cheia 4/4: d – d u – u d –. O groove fica em torno de 80 bpm, um ritmo relaxado. Nesta página a música está em Db menor. Os acordes caem no território confortável de habilidoso. Let chords ring in the verses and grow the strum toward the chorus.
4 acordes de ukulele em "Mrs. Potato Head" de Melanie Martinez: A, B, Dbm e E
